In farm animals, gonads are organs associated with reproduction. Gonads are the organs responsible for producing gametes (sperm in males and eggs in females), which are needed for sexual reproduction. In males, the gonads are called testes and they produce sperm. In females, the gonads are called ovaries and they produce eggs. These gametes are necessary for the fertilization of eggs and the production of offspring. Therefore, the gonads are crucial organs in the process of reproduction in farm animals.
